Linux字符串拼接技术精要(linux字符串拼接)

Linux是众多操作系统中最为流行的一款,在Linux开发技术中,字符串拼接使开发者们特别重视。字符串拼接的行为可以看做是把一个或多个字符串合并到一起,从而得到新的字符串。 在Linux中,字符串拼接有很多方法可以使用,具体取决于流程。对于动态编程,使用C语言实现字符串拼接可以使用以下函数:strcat() 和strncat()。

strcat()函数可以用于将字符串src拼接到dest后面,如下所示:

strcat(char* dest,const char* src);

strncat()函数可以将从src开始n个字符拼接到dest后面,如下所示:

strncat(char* dest,const char* src, size_t n); 

对于函数strcat() 来说,可以省略参数n,大多数情况下只需传入源字符串src 和 目的字符串dest,就能实现字符串拼接。两个常用的函数strcat() 和strncat()都可以用来实现字符串拼接,但是strncat()的灵活性大一些,可以指定n个字符来拼接。

此外,Python也可以实现Linux字符串拼接,可以使用join函数来实现,关键字是 “.”,代码示例如下:

str1 = "Linux" 
str2 = "字符串拼接"

# 使用join函数来拼接字符串
str3 = ".".join([str1, str2])

# 输出结果
print(str3) #Linux 字符串拼接

总结而言,Linux中字符串拼接技术非常便捷,可以使用C语言的函数strcat() 和strncat() 来实现拼接,也可以使用Python语言的join函数来实现拼接。此外,还有其他的拼接函数可以满足Linux中的应用场景。因此,Linux字符串拼接技术可以为开发者们提供更加先进的开发能力,促进整个Linux技术的发展。


数据运维技术 » Linux字符串拼接技术精要(linux字符串拼接)